Merkel urges 'respectful dialogue' in Turkey after referendum

German Chancellor Angela Merkel today urged Turkey's President Recep Tayyip Erdogan to seek "respectful dialogue" within the country after his narrow win in a referendum extending his powers.
"The (German) government expects that the Turkish government will now seek respectful dialogue with all political and social forces in the country, after this tough election campaign," Merkel said in a statement issued jointly with foreign minister Sigmar Gabriel.
